A sliding mode control design is presented for a test mass suspension control problem applied to the LISA Pathfinder mission. LISA Pathfinder is an ESA enabling technology project for LISA, a spaceborne gravitational wave detector. The LISA technology package on board LISA Pathfinder features two high precision gravitational reference sensors, each of them encompassing a free floating cubic test mass surrounded by a capacitive housing. This paper covers equipment modeling, actuation strategy description, controller law definition and design rules, stability and robustness analysis, performance results, and comparison with standard control design.
